©2001 Andersen. All Rights Reserved. Proprietary and Confidential. 작성일 : 2010 교육 자료 QNAP NAS (Network Attached Storage) 교육 자료
NAS 의 기본 개념 -1 ▶ 최근 멀티미디어 용도의 세컨드 PC 와 업무용 / 휴대용 노트북의 보급화가 빠른 속도로 진행되면서 데이터 백업을 위한 스토리지의 중요성이 크게 대두되고 있음 ▶ NAS(Network Attached Storage) 는 네트워크에 연결된 저장 장치를 뜻하는 말로 언제 어디서든 편리한 접속이 가능하고, 대용량 데이터의 백업을 비롯해 파일 공유와 다양한 서비스를 한 곳에서 즐길 수 있다는 이점 때문에 차세대 스토리지로써 크게 각광을 받음 ▶ 서버에서 사용되는 NAS 제품이 성능과 확장성 위주의 고가 제품이라면, 소형 NAS 는 가정에서 필요한 기능을 쉽게 사용하는 것을 주 목적으로 하고 있다. 때문에 대부분의 소형 NAS 제품들은 공유기 관리자 페이지처럼 웹으로 접속해서 간단히 설정할 수 있는 편리한 기능을 갖추고 있다.
NAS 의 기본 개념 -2 ▶ 만일 누군가 혼자 집, 회사 등 여러 곳에서 같은 자료를 사용하고자 한다면 USB 메모리나 소형 외장하드와 같은 휴대용 스토리지를 사용하는 것이 가장 편리할 것이다. 직관적인 인터페이스에 저렴한 가격까지 갖추고 있기 때문이다. ▶ 하지만 두 명 이상이 다른 공간에서 같은 자료를 공유해야 한다면 외장 하드로는 요구 조건을 만족시킬 수 없게 된다. 이러한 경우 국내 유저들은 보통 ' 웹하드 ' 를 떠올리게 될 것이다. 인터넷이 보급화됨에 따라 편리한 사용이 가능해졌기 때문이다. ▶ NAS 와 웹하드는 완전한 경쟁 관계라기보다는 상호 보완적인 역할을 한다고 볼 수 있다. 다시 말해 필요에 의해 선택하거나, 적절한 조합으로 사용될 수 있는 서로 조금씩 다른 영역의 서비스들인 셈이다. ▶ 웹하드는 운영하기 위한 작업이 필요 없고, 간단히 가입과 초기 구축 비용 없이 매달 일정액만으로 사용이 가능하다는 이점을 갖고 있지만, 이에 반해 GB~TB 단위의 공간을 장기간 사용하기에는 적합하지 않다는 단점도 갖고 있다. ▶ 이럴 경우에 적합한 것이 바로 NAS 이다. BAY 수 만큼 공간의 초기 구축 비용만으로 얼마든지 유지할 수 있다. 또한 사용자 계정도 원하는 만큼 생성할 수 있다. ▶ 물론 일반 PC 로도 NAS 를 구축할 수 있다. 하지만 통합된 관리자 페이지가 없고 윈도우를 구입한다면 가격적인 이득도 상당히 줄어들게 된다. 게다가 구축에 시간이 꽤 걸리는 경우가 많고, 인건비를 고려해보면 일반적인 작은 사무실이나 집에서는 쉽지 않은 선택일 것으로 보인다.
NAS 의 기본 개념 -3 ▶ 추가적인 오류 교정 데이터 없이 데이터가 분산 저장되기 때문에 빠른 입출력이 가능하다. ▶ 성능은 뛰어나지만 오류가 발생했을 경우 복구가 불가능하다. 1. RAID0 (Stripe) 2. RAID1 (Mirror) ▶ 빠른 기록 속도와 함께 장애 복구 능력이 요구되는 경우 사용 ▶ 두 개의 디스크에 데이터가 동일하게 기록되므로 데이터의 복구 능력은 높지만, 전체 용량의 절반이 데이터를 기록하기 위해 사용되기 때문에 저장용량당 단가가 비싼 편 RAID (Redundant Array of Independent Disks) 는 여러 개의 하드디스크를 통하여 대용량 디스크 또는 데이터의 전송 속도 증가, 데이터의 백업 / 안정성을 높이는데 사용이 된다
NAS 의 기본 개념 -4 ▶ 최소 3 개 이상의 디스크에서 구성 ▶ 패리티 정보를 모든 드라이브에 나눠 기록하며 디스크 1 개까지의 오류에 대응가능 ▶ 작고 랜덤한 입출력이 많은 경우 더 나은 성능을 제공 ▶ 현재 가장 많이 사용되는 RAID 방식 ▶ Hot Spare 를 선택할 경우 이 디스크는 대기상태가 되며 1 개의 디스크가 Fail 일 경우 자동으로 대체 3. RAID5 ▶ 최소 4 개 이상의 디스크에서 구성 ▶ RAID5 와 비슷하지만, 다른 드라이브들 간에 분포되어 있는 2 차 패리티 구성을 포함 ▶ 높은 장애 대비 능력 제공 ▶ 6Bay 이상의 NAS 에서 구성 빈도 높음 4. RAID6
NAS 의 기본 개념 -5 ▶ 공인 (Public) IP 는 인터넷상에 하나밖에 없는 유일한 IP 를 뜻하는 것으로 IP 만 알면 외부에서 IP 가 부여된 기기에 직접 접속 할 수 있는 것이 특징 ▶ 사설 (private) IP 는 이름에서 보듯이 공유기를 통해 네부네트워크에서만 사용하는 IP 로 외부에서 직접 접속 할 수는 없지만 많은 IP 를 부여할 수 있는 것이 특징 ▶ 공인 IP 는 대부분 유동 IP 이기 때문에 자주 바뀌므로 외부에 알려주거나 과 같은 도메인에 연결 할 수 없다. 이런 환경에서는 외부에서 접속하는데 매우 불편하므로 IP 가 변경될 때마다 DNS 에 반영해서 동일한 도메인으로 접속할 수 있게 해주는 것이 'DDNS' 이다. ▶ 공유기 업체나 NAS 제조사 등에서 서비스 하고 있는 경우가 많고 이외에도 외국의 등에서도 무료로 서비스 하고 있다. ▶ QNAP NAS 에서는 사이트에서 등록 후 사용 할 수 있다.
NAS 의 기본 개념 -6 ▶ 일반적으로 [ 시작 ]->[ 실행 ]->[\\NAS IP 주소 ] 와 같은 형식 또는 전체네트워크에서 NAS 의 이름을 찾아서 접속 ▶ NAS 접속 후 “ 네트워크 드라이브 연결 ” 을 하면 편리하게 접속 가능
NAS 의 기본 개념 -7 ▶ 2 개의 랜포트를 이용하여 서브넷이 다른 2 개의 작업그룹에서 접속 가능 ▶ 단, 게이트웨는 1 개만 설정 가능. 따라서 2 개의 공인 IP 는 사용 불가 ▶ 포트 트렁킹은 두 개의 이더넷을 하나로 묶어 분산처리 또는 장애 극복의 용도로 쓰임
QNAP 기본 설정 -1 ▶ 단일 사용자 계정 만들기 ▶ 파일 형태로 된 사용자 가져오기 ▶ 접두사를 이용하여 복수 사용자 만들기
QNAP 기본 설정 -2 ▶ 공유폴더에 권한설정 ( 손님과 사용자 계정에 대한 읽기, 읽기쓰기, 거부 권한 부여 ) ▶ 최상위 폴더에만 권한설정 가능 ▶ NFS, WebDAV 별도 권한 지정
QNAP 기본 설정 -3 ▶ 전체 용량 할당에서 사용자에게 할당 할 최대 사이즈를 입력 ( 최대 2TB) ▶ [ 할당보기 ] 를 통해 각 사용자가 사용하고 있는 용량 확인가능 ▶ 사용자 용량 할당은 전체 용량 할당사이즈를 초과할 수 없음
▶ FTP 란 File Transfer Protocol 의 약자로, 원격 서버에 파일을 주고 받을 때 사용하는 인터넷 통신 규약 ▶ FTP 프로그램은 파일을 업로드 / 다운로드하기 위하여 사용하며 대표적으로는 FileZilla, 알 FTP, Cute FTP 등이 있다. ▶ NAS 의 관리 -> 네트워크서비스 -> FTP 서비스 에서 설정 QNAP 기본 설정 -4
QNAP 기본 설정 -5 ▶ 외부에서의 원활한 접속을 위해서는 공유기의 포트포워딩 설정을 해야 한다. ▶ 주요 사용 포트 -> FTP : 21, Management : 8080, SSH : 22, 웹서버 : 80
QNAP 활용 -1 ▶ 번들로 제공되는 NetBak Replicator 를 이용하여 PC 에 있는 데이터를 NAS 로 실시간, 즉시백업, 스케줄을 통해 백업 받을 수 있다.
QNAP 활용 -2 ▶ NAS 후면에 USB 또는 e-SATA 드라이브를 연결하여 백업 가능 ▶ 전면의 USB 포트에 디스크를 연결하면 버튼 한번으로 내부디스크 USB 저장장치로 간편하게 백업 가능
QNAP 활용 -3 ▶ iSCSI(Internet Small Computer Systems Interface) 란 광케이블 기반의 SAN 시스템을 대체하기 위한 IP 기반의 파일 전송 프로토콜이다. ▶ NAS 에서 지원하는 iSCSI 타켓 서비스 기능을 활성화하고 PC 에 iSCSI Initiator 를 설치하면 간단하게 IP SAN 형태의 구성이 가능하다. ▶총 8 개의 iSCSI 대상 지원 ▶ 1 개의 iSCSI 대상 당 4 개의 LUN 생성 가능
QNAP 활용 -4 ▶ NAS 에서 제공되는 웹파일 매니저를 이용하면 외부에서 쉽게 파일을 관리 할 수 있습니다. ▶ 파일의 업, 다운로드 기능 및 새 폴더, 이름변경, 이동, 복사 기능 제공 ▶ 다수의 파일 및 폴더 다운로드는 압축된 형태로만 다운로드 가능
QNAP 활용 -5 ▶ 이미지, 미디어 파일 보기 ▶ 개인 앨범을 쉽게 관리
QNAP 활용 -6 ▶ 아파치, MySQL 의 내장으로 누구나 자신만의 홈페이지 구축 ▶ phpMyAdmin 으로 DB 관리를 쉽게 할 수 있다. ▶ 웹서버,MySQL 활성화 후 phpMyAdmin 을 통해 DB 생성 -> 제로보드 설치
QNAP 활용 -7 ▶ QNAP NAS 는 QPKG 를 통해 사용자가 간단하게 어플리케이션을 추가 / 삭제 할 수 있게 지원 ▶ AjaXplorer 는 설치형 웹하드 솔루션으로 쉽고 간편하게 구축할 수 있으며 Ajax 기반으로 제작되어 ActiveX 를 사용하지 않을 뿐만 아니라 Firefox, Chome 등의 웹브라우져에서 호환가능
QNAP 관리 -1 ▶ NAS 뒷면의 “reset” 스위치를 눌러 시스템을 재설정 할 수 있다.
QNAP 관리 -2 ▶ 시스템 이벤트 로그를 통해 NAS 의 정보, 경고, 오류 확인이 가능하며 시스템 연결 로그를 통해 사용자 데이터의 읽기, 쓰기, 변경 상태를 확인 할 수 있다. ▶ [ 디스크관리 ]->[ 볼륨관리 ] 에서 각 디스크에 대한 상태 및 점검을 할 수 있으며 논리적 볼륨의 포맷, 점검, 제거가 가능하다.
QNAP 관리 -3 ▶ 데이터의 백업 없이 온라인상에서 레이드의 디스크 추가, 용량확장 및 다른 레이드 레벨로 변경하는 마이그레이션이 가능. [ 디스크 관리 ] ->[ 레이드 관리 ]
Q&A
수고하셨습니다 !! 전화 :